Eden Ritchie Recruitment are seeking an experienced Procurement and Contracts Officer to support the delivery of procurement and contracting activities within a Queensland Government environment.

This 6-month opportunity will have a strong focus on Learning & Development procurement, alongside broader operational procurement activities. You will work closely with internal stakeholders, providing practical procurement advice and supporting sourcing, evaluation and contract management processes.

Key responsibilities

- Support end-to-end procurement planning and sourcing activities, including documentation, market release, evaluations and contract formation.
- Provide procurement advice to stakeholders, particularly across Learning & Development procurement.
- Assist with the preparation of procurement plans, evaluation plans and briefing notes for senior and executive management.
- Support stakeholders to develop specifications and determine appropriate procurement strategies.
- Assist with contract negotiation, management and administration activities.
- Prepare purchase requisitions and liaise with shared service providers regarding purchase orders and vendor discrepancies.
- Prepare vendor creations and extensions within SAP.
- Liaise with Finance and Budgeting teams regarding day-to-day procurement matters.




- Support the central procurement inbox and associated records management using SharePoint Online and shared drives.

About you To be successful, you will ideally demonstrate:

- Recent Queensland Government procurement experience within the last 6–12 months.
- Knowledge and practical experience applying the Queensland Procurement Policy and associated procedures.
- Experience undertaking operational procurement activities.
- Experience developing Queensland Government RFQs, tenders, contracts and associated documentation.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.
- The ability to effectively engage with stakeholders and provide practical procurement advice.
- Strong organisational skills with the ability to manage competing priorities and deadlines.
- Experience using SAP financial systems.
- Previous Learning & Development procurement experience will be highly regarded.
